Cardiff head coach Brian Barry-Murphy praised his team’s relentless spirit after they brushed aside AFC Wimbledon 4-1 at the Cardiff City Stadium.
The Bluebirds stretched their unbeaten run to 12 matches and maintained a four-point lead over Lincoln, while also extending the gap to 12 points between themselves and the play-off places.
